GETTYSBURG, Pa. (October 3, 2021) – OPEN MINDS has announced that Joseph Kvedar, M.D., Vice President Of Connected Health, Health Partners Massachusetts and President, American Telehealth Association, and Joseph Lee, M.D., President and Chief Executive Officer, Hazelden Betty Ford Foundation will headline The 2021 OPEN MINDS Technology & Analytic Institute, kicking off on Monday, October 25, 2021. The institute has dozens of sessions and experiential learning activities designed to guide health care executives serving consumers with complex needs, leverage technology for strategic advantage, and prepare for transformational leadership in the year ahead.

“For success and sustainability in health and human services, all roads lead to technology,” said Monica Oss, Chief Executive Officer at OPEN MINDS. “Executive’s ability to leverage data and technology will determine their competitive advantage in the changing health and human services field. Our three-day institute provides a deep dive into the technology-related strategic issues that executives need to address.”

ABOUT OPEN MINDS

OPEN MINDS is a national market intelligence, management consulting, and marketing services firm specializing exclusively in the markets of the health and human service field that serve consumers with chronic conditions and complex support needs. OPEN MINDS’ mission is to provide payers, service provider organizations, and technology and scientific firms that serve these consumers with the market and management knowledge needed to improve their organizational efficiency and effectiveness.
